  • Color Days

    Kindergarteners are working on reading color words. Let's come together as a school and help them see these colors as they are learning them. If you would like to participate, below is the schedule for which color they are practicing each day. You can wear a shirt, pants, socks, shoes, or anything else school-appropriate that matches the color of the day! Thank you for helping to make learning fun!

    9/25 Red
    9/26 Yellow
    9/27 Orange
    9/28 Blue
    9/29 Green
    10/2 Purple/Pink
    10/3 Brown/Black/White/Gray
    10/4 Rainbow
